Choosing between shared hosting, VPS hosting, and managed hosting is less about picking the “best” plan and more about matching your site’s needs to the right balance of cost, control, performance, and maintenance. This guide gives you a practical way to compare the three models, estimate total cost beyond the sticker price, and decide when it makes sense to stay simple, upgrade for flexibility, or pay for a managed layer that reduces operational work.
Overview
If you are comparing VPS vs shared hosting or trying to make sense of a broader managed hosting comparison, the easiest mistake is to focus only on monthly price. That works for a hobby site, but it breaks down quickly for business sites, client projects, WordPress installs with plugins, staging workflows, or applications that need predictable resources.
At a high level:
- Shared hosting is the lowest-friction entry point. You share server resources and the provider handles most platform basics. It is usually the simplest option for small, low-complexity sites.
- VPS hosting gives you a defined slice of compute resources and more control over the environment. It usually suits growing sites, custom stacks, and teams that want flexibility.
- Managed hosting adds an operational layer on top of hosting. Depending on the provider, that may include updates, security hardening, backups, monitoring, performance tuning, staging, and support tuned for a specific platform such as WordPress.
None of these is universally right. The right choice depends on five questions:
- How much traffic and variability does your site handle?
- How sensitive are you to slowdowns or downtime?
- How much server control do you need?
- How much time can your team realistically spend on maintenance?
- What is the real cost of mistakes, delays, or outages?
That last question matters most. A plan that looks cheap can become expensive if it costs developer time, creates migration friction, or makes incidents harder to diagnose. On the other hand, a premium managed plan may be unnecessary if your site is simple and your team is comfortable managing its own stack.
Think of the decision as a three-way tradeoff:
- Shared hosting: lowest cost, lowest control
- VPS hosting: balanced cost, higher control
- Managed hosting: higher cost, lower maintenance burden
If your site is mostly static, receives modest traffic, and does not justify infrastructure work, shared hosting may be enough. If you need custom services, isolated resources, or room to tune performance, VPS is often the more durable choice. If uptime, support, speed, and operational simplicity matter more than raw control, managed hosting is often the strongest fit.
How to estimate
The most useful way to compare shared vs VPS vs managed is to estimate total monthly operating cost, not just hosting spend. You can do that with a simple framework.
Formula:
Total monthly hosting cost = base hosting fee + add-on services + maintenance time cost + incident risk cost + migration or scaling overhead
Here is how each part works.
1. Base hosting fee
This is the advertised monthly or annualized cost of the plan. Keep it separate from introductory pricing. For evergreen comparisons, use the renewal price or standard price whenever possible in your own calculations.
2. Add-on services
Some plans include features that others bill separately. These may include:
- Backups
- SSL certificates or certificate management
- Malware scanning
- CDN services
- Email hosting
- Staging environments
- Priority support
- Control panels or management tools
A low-priced VPS can stop looking inexpensive once you add backup storage, monitoring, and managed support. A shared plan can also become less attractive if it lacks basic features you need for launches or migrations.
3. Maintenance time cost
This is where many comparisons become more realistic. Estimate how many hours per month your team spends on tasks such as:
- System updates
- Plugin or application testing
- Security checks
- Backup verification
- Performance tuning
- Log review and troubleshooting
- Support interactions
Then multiply by your internal hourly rate or an estimated value of that time. Even if you do not bill that time directly, it still represents opportunity cost.
Example structure:
- Shared hosting: 1 to 3 maintenance hours per month
- VPS hosting: 3 to 8 hours per month
- Managed hosting: 0.5 to 2 hours per month
These are not market claims or fixed benchmarks. They are planning ranges you can adjust based on your own technical comfort and stack complexity.
4. Incident risk cost
Not every site needs formal risk modeling, but a simple estimate is helpful. Ask:
- What does one hour of downtime cost us?
- How often do we expect urgent support or recovery work?
- How costly is a misconfiguration or failed update?
For a personal site, the risk cost may be minimal. For a lead-generation site, ecommerce store, SaaS landing page, or membership site, the cost can be meaningful even at moderate traffic levels.
5. Migration or scaling overhead
Some hosting choices are inexpensive now but create friction later. If you are likely to outgrow a plan soon, include the expected cost of migration, retesting, DNS changes, and internal coordination. If you expect steady growth, it can be cheaper overall to choose a platform with a cleaner upgrade path.
For help when that time comes, see Website Migration Checklist: Moving Hosts Without Downtime.
A simple decision scorecard
If you want a repeatable process, score each option from 1 to 5 across these categories:
- Monthly budget fit
- Performance headroom
- Ease of maintenance
- Security comfort
- Support quality needed
- Control and customization
- Upgrade path
Then weight the categories based on what matters most to your project. A developer tool, content site, and business homepage should not all be scored the same way.
Inputs and assumptions
To make the estimate useful, decide on your inputs before comparing plans. The goal is not precision down to the last dollar. The goal is to avoid choosing the wrong hosting type because you ignored a major operational cost.
Traffic pattern
Monthly visits matter, but variability matters more. A site with predictable traffic may run well on modest resources. A site with traffic spikes from launches, campaigns, or seasonal demand may need more isolation and headroom.
Shared hosting is often most comfortable when traffic is moderate and burst behavior is limited. VPS hosting is usually easier to reason about when you need more predictable resources. Managed hosting can make sense when the business wants performance support without handling the infrastructure directly.
Application complexity
A static site, brochure site, or lightweight CMS install has very different hosting needs from a WordPress build with many plugins, a custom app, or a database-heavy membership site.
As complexity rises, two things become more valuable:
- Resource isolation
- Access to tuning and troubleshooting tools
That is often where VPS or managed environments become more attractive than entry-level shared plans.
Control requirements
If you need root access, custom packages, background services, nonstandard runtimes, or deployment workflows, shared hosting may feel restrictive. VPS is usually the better fit for these use cases. Managed hosting can still work if the provider supports the stack you need, but managed platforms often impose guardrails by design.
This is not a flaw. Guardrails are valuable if your priority is reliability over customization.
Maintenance burden
This is the most overlooked input. Ask who will own:
- OS and package updates
- Web server configuration
- Runtime version management
- Security patching
- Backups and restores
- Monitoring and alerting
If the answer is “probably us, when we have time,” then unmanaged or lightly managed infrastructure may be riskier than it appears.
Support expectations
Support quality is not identical across providers, but the type of support usually differs by hosting model. Shared hosting support often centers on account-level and platform basics. VPS support may stop at infrastructure boundaries unless management is included. Managed hosting typically places more value on platform-specific help and operational guidance.
If your team needs quick answers during launches, migrations, or performance issues, support should be part of the comparison, not an afterthought.
Security and trust needs
Every site should account for SSL, backups, updates, and basic security hygiene. If you manage customer data, user accounts, or business-critical forms, the operational side of security matters as much as the certificate in the browser bar.
For related reading, see Free SSL vs Paid SSL Certificates: Features, Support, and Renewal Tradeoffs and SSL Certificate Guide: DV vs OV vs EV and When Each Still Makes Sense.
Domain and DNS complexity
Hosting decisions often touch DNS management, email routing, and launch coordination. If you are moving a site, changing nameservers, or keeping email separate from web hosting, factor that into your planning. A hosting choice that simplifies deployment but complicates DNS may not actually reduce workload.
Useful references include Nameservers vs DNS Records: Which Should You Change and When? and How to Connect a Domain to Your Hosting Provider.
Worked examples
The examples below use assumptions, not market pricing. They are meant to show how to think about the decision.
Example 1: Small brochure site for a local business
Profile: A five-page website, contact form, light blog usage, no custom application logic, limited traffic, no in-house sysadmin.
Likely priorities: low cost, easy setup, minimal maintenance, reliable SSL, simple backups.
Best fit: Shared hosting or entry managed hosting.
Why: The site does not need deep server control. Paying for a VPS may add work without delivering meaningful business value. If the owner wants the simplest experience and stronger hands-on support, a managed option can still be worth it. If budget is the top constraint and the feature set is adequate, shared hosting is often enough.
Related guide: How to Choose Cloud Hosting for a Small Business Website.
Example 2: Growing content site with traffic spikes
Profile: A CMS-driven publication with periodic spikes from newsletters or social traffic, multiple plugins, and a need for stable performance.
Likely priorities: performance consistency, easier scaling, backup reliability, support during traffic bursts.
Best fit: VPS hosting or managed hosting.
Why: Shared hosting may be fine early on, but burst traffic and plugin-heavy workloads can expose resource limits quickly. A VPS provides clearer resource allocation and room for tuning. Managed hosting becomes attractive if the team wants performance assistance and reduced maintenance overhead.
If the site runs on WordPress and editorial uptime matters, compare platform management costs carefully. This is where operational convenience can justify a higher monthly plan.
See also WordPress Hosting Comparison: Managed WordPress vs General Cloud Hosting.
Example 3: Developer-run application with custom stack requirements
Profile: A web app that needs custom runtimes, scheduled jobs, environment variables, deployment control, and access to logs and services.
Likely priorities: flexibility, root or near-root access, isolation, predictable resources.
Best fit: VPS hosting.
Why: Shared hosting is typically too restrictive. Managed hosting may be too opinionated unless it specifically supports the stack. A VPS usually gives the best balance of control and cost. The tradeoff is that the team must be willing to handle more operational work or pay for managed services on top.
Example 4: Business-critical WordPress site with lean internal team
Profile: A marketing or lead-generation site where speed, uptime, backups, staging, and plugin update workflows matter, but the internal team does not want to maintain servers.
Likely priorities: low operational burden, strong support, safer updates, restore confidence.
Best fit: Managed hosting.
Why: This is the clearest case for paying a premium to reduce maintenance load. If one failed update or performance issue can disrupt campaigns, sales, or lead flow, managed hosting often provides the best operational fit.
Example 5: Early-stage project with uncertain growth
Profile: A new site or app where usage is unknown, budgets are tight, and technical requirements may evolve.
Likely priorities: low initial spend, clean migration path, avoiding overbuying.
Best fit: Start with shared hosting if the stack is simple; choose VPS early if custom requirements already exist.
Why: Early-stage projects should avoid paying for unused capacity. The key is to choose a provider or setup that does not make migration painful later. If growth or complexity arrives, revisit the numbers rather than defaulting to the next plan tier automatically.
Before launch, it helps to review How to Launch a Website on a New Domain: End-to-End Setup Checklist.
When to recalculate
Your hosting decision should be revisited whenever the inputs change. This article is most useful if you return to it at those moments instead of treating hosting as a one-time choice.
Recalculate if any of the following happens:
- Your traffic pattern changes, especially if spikes become more common
- Your application becomes more complex or plugin-heavy
- Your team changes and no one clearly owns server maintenance
- You launch ecommerce, memberships, or customer logins
- Your current support experience slows down launches or incident response
- Your renewal pricing changes substantially
- You are planning a migration, redesign, or platform rebuild
- You add custom email routing, external DNS, or more complex domain setup
For example, a shared plan that was sensible six months ago may no longer be the right hosting for a growing website if your team is now spending several hours each month troubleshooting performance or failed updates. In that case, the plan did not become “bad”; the inputs changed.
Use this short action checklist when you revisit the decision:
- Write down your current standard monthly hosting cost at renewal, not intro price.
- List every paid add-on tied to the site.
- Estimate monthly maintenance time in hours.
- Estimate the business impact of one hour of downtime or a broken deployment.
- Score your need for control from 1 to 5.
- Score your tolerance for maintenance from 1 to 5.
- Ask whether your next likely step is optimization, migration, or simplification.
If your maintenance burden and risk exposure are climbing faster than your hosting fee, a move toward managed hosting may be rational. If your need for flexibility is climbing faster than support needs, VPS may be the better upgrade. If your site remains simple and stable, shared hosting may continue to be the most efficient choice.
The best hosting type is the one that fits the current version of your site without creating unnecessary operational drag. Compare the full cost, not just the monthly plan. Then choose the model that your team can run confidently.